Phnom Penh: Previously, Cambodia has never won a medal at the Olympic Games. For 2028, it is a valuable opportunity for Cambodian athletes to win medals and bring honor to the country.

This is the will and main direction in the preparation of Cambodian athletes as well as the National Olympic Committee and partners co-sponsored by Vattanac.

In the spirit of One Khmer, One Direction, on July 22, 2026, Vattanac organized a signing ceremony for an important memorandum of understanding with the National Olympic Committee of Cambodia (NOCC) on the path to the 2028 Olympic Games in Los Angeles, USA.

This valuable ceremony was presided over by Mr. Vath Chamroeun, Secretary General of the National Olympic Committee of Cambodia (NOCC), and Oknha Sam Ang Vattanac, CEO of Vattanac, and was attended by Vattanac’s team, as well as sports officials, coaches, and national athletes.
Preparations And the strategic direction towards the upcoming international competition in 2028, Mr. Vath Chamroeun stated that Cambodia has been preparing a detailed plan to
train athletes and coaches in 10 potential sports including taekwondo, wrestling, boxing, athletics, swimming, mountaineering, as well as other potential sports of Cambodia.
In response to the mechanism to support and promote national sports for this event, Vattanac Company has created a special initiative: withdrawing a portion of the funds from the sale of Vattanac Company products to participate as a fund to support training and improve the capabilities of athletes and coaches to prepare them for the journey towards winning their first Olympic medal and bringing pride to the motherland for this important sporting event.
